These figures are assumptions stated out loud, not predictions about your business. Memory, cores and disk can all be raised on the same server later, usually within the hour, with no rebuild and no new IP address — so starting one size below the estimate is normally the cheaper mistake.

Which tiers suit Ride-Hailing

Including the ones that do not, and why — that is usually the more useful half.

Infrastructure Verdict Why
Shared Hosting Managed space on a shared server Not this one Persistent connections and custom ports are exactly what a shared platform does not permit.
VPS Flexible virtual infrastructure with full root access Workable Enough for a small server or a test instance, though a noisy neighbour shows up immediately as jitter.
VDS Virtual server with resources pinned to you alone Recommended Pinned cores are what keep tick rate and call quality steady; on a contended instance they are not.
Dedicated Server An entire physical server, configured to your specification Recommended Single-tenant hardware removes the last source of variance, which is what these workloads are judged on.
Bare Metal Physical compute for sustained, demanding workloads Workable For operators running many instances at once on hardware they control.
